Isles of Scilly Route

Many residents and visitors greatly miss the S-61 service which operated on the Penzance to Scillies route for decades. The fixedwing Skybus service from Lands End using Islanders and Twin Otters costs around £160 return for the twenty eight mile crossing to the islands. Much talk continues with suggestions on the feasibility of reinstating a helicopter service and perhaps predictably in election year, local political figures loom large in such chatter. There are suggestions the AW189 might be used.


As someone with more than a passing interest in the islands, I wonder if those of you on this forum might care to comment on the feasibility of such a move, how many will it carry including luggage, wuold it be a commercially viable option? The former operating base at Penzance is now a newly opened supermarket and Skybus who own Lands End airport would not be amenable to share heir facility with competition of this kind.


Indicative of the chatter on the islands on the subject, someone has recently suggested introducing a seventy five seater Dornier on the route in to St. Mary's Airport, runway if memory serves me correctly being just 15/1600 ft. !
